What can I do to stop the screech that happens after I turn on my car?

My car is a 1991 Toyota Camry Dx. It has just
started to make this loud, screeching noise after I
turn on my car. The car is pretty old and worn
down, and we’ve had to make numerous repairs on
it so many new parts used to replace the old. Any
idea what it could be?? Thank you.

What Engine in this vehicle? Any warning lights on or flashing when the engine is running? Sounds like the Engine Drive Belt and or belt Tensioner may need to be replaced. Try this. Put some water in a discarded squirt bottle. Squirt the drive belts with water. Restart the engine and see if the noise changes or goes away. Get back with results.
